Why Youngstown Rates Vary This Much

Ohio allows county-level and ZIP-level rating factors. Carriers build actuarial models predicting loss ratios by geography, and Mahoning County's uninsured motorist rate, theft density, and claims frequency place it in different tiers depending on the carrier's book of business. Bristol West may write Youngstown as Tier 2 while Dairyland writes it as Tier 3. Same county, different actuarial judgment.

SR-22 filing adds administrative cost — typically $15–$25 per policy term — but the filing itself does not triple your rate. The violation that triggered SR-22 requirement (OVI, reckless driving, driving under suspension) moves you from standard-tier to non-standard-tier carriers. Non-standard carriers like Bristol West, Dairyland, Direct Auto, GAINSCO, and The General specialize in high-risk drivers and price competitively within that segment, but their Youngstown tier assignments diverge.

The carrier that quoted you $220/month is not overcharging — they tier Mahoning County higher than competitors. The carrier quoting $85/month tiers it lower. Both are actuarially defensible. Your job is to find the carrier whose actuarial model favors your ZIP code, not to negotiate the model itself.

How to Compare Youngstown SR-22 Quotes

Request quotes from at least three non-standard carriers: one from Dairyland, one from Bristol West or Direct Auto, and one from GAINSCO or The General. Provide identical coverage limits to each: Ohio's minimum liability (25/50/25) or higher limits if you own a financed vehicle requiring comprehensive and collision. Request the same deductibles and confirm each quote includes SR-22 filing.

Quote aggregators often miss county-specific pricing nuances because they pull cached rates or default tiers. Calling carriers directly or working with an independent agent who writes multiple non-standard carriers surfaces the actual Youngstown-specific tier each carrier assigns. Ask the agent which carrier currently tiers Mahoning County most favorably — this changes quarterly as carriers adjust books of business.

If you do not currently own a vehicle, request non-owner SR-22 quotes. Non-owner policies satisfy Ohio's proof of financial responsibility requirement without insuring a specific car. Monthly premiums for non-owner SR-22 in Youngstown typically range $40–$75/month, significantly cheaper than owner policies because the carrier assumes lower loss exposure. Dairyland, GAINSCO, The General, and Geico all write non-owner SR-22 in Ohio.

Ohio SR-22 Filing Period

3 years

Ohio requires continuous SR-22 filing for 3 years following conviction for OVI, reckless driving, or driving under suspension. The 3-year clock starts from the conviction date, not the filing date. If your policy lapses or cancels during this period, your carrier notifies the BMV and your license is suspended again within 10 days.

Ohio Revised Code 4509.45

What Happens If Your Youngstown SR-22 Lapses

Ohio law requires your carrier to notify the BMV electronically within 24 hours if your SR-22 policy cancels or lapses for non-payment. The BMV suspends your driving privileges immediately — typically within 10 days of receiving the lapse notification. There is no grace period. Reinstatement after an SR-22 lapse requires purchasing a new policy with SR-22 filing, paying a $40 BMV reinstatement fee, and restarting your 3-year SR-22 clock from the new filing date.

Setting up automatic payment prevents the most common lapse trigger: missed payment deadlines. Switching carriers mid-term is allowed, but coordinate the transition so the new carrier files SR-22 before the old policy expires. A gap of even one day between cancellation and new filing triggers BMV suspension.
